The View of Zrmanja Canyon from Pariževačka Glavica offers a spectacular panorama of one of Croatia's most dramatic natural landscapes. This prominent viewpoint is situated high above the Zrmanja River as it carves its way through a deep canyon, located in the wider Velebit Nature Park area. Found near the village of Jasenice, approximately a 45-minute drive from Zadar, it provides an unparalleled perspective of the winding river and the surrounding karst topography.

The path to the viewpoint is generally easy and largely level, but it is a rocky plateau. Hikers should expect uneven, natural terrain. Comfortable footwear suitable for rocky surfaces is advisable to ensure a pleasant and safe experience.
Yes, the viewpoint is considered family-friendly due to the relatively easy and short walk from the parking area. It is also generally dog-friendly, making it a great spot for a family outing with pets. However, visitors with children and dogs should exercise extreme caution near the canyon edges, as there are no safety rails.
No, there is no entrance fee to visit the viewpoint at Pariževačka Glavica. It is freely accessible to the public, and no permits are required for access.
Public transport options directly to Pariževačka Glavica are limited. The viewpoint is best accessed by car, with parking available nearby. It's approximately a 45-minute drive from Zadar. While the final stretch of road may be unpaved, it is typically reachable by vehicle.
Pariževačka Glavica is located in a natural, somewhat remote area near the village of Jasenice. While the immediate vicinity of the viewpoint does not feature cafes, pubs, or extensive accommodation, you can find options in nearby towns like Obrovac or further afield in Zadar. It's best to plan for refreshments and lodging before or after your visit.
Pariževačka Glavica holds a special place in cinematic history as a prominent filming location for the famous 'Winnetou' movies. From this viewpoint, you are standing in what was depicted as 'Pueblo Plato,' the Indian village and homeland of the Apache chief Winnetou. The Zrmanja River below famously stood in for the fictional Rio Pecos, making it a significant site for fans of the films.
While the Zrmanja River is known for its beautiful emerald green waters, the viewpoint at Pariževačka Glavica is high above the canyon, making direct access for swimming difficult. Rafting and kayaking trips on the Zrmanja River are popular activities, especially during summer when water levels are lower. These activities typically start from different access points along the river, not directly from the viewpoint.
The Zrmanja Canyon is a prime example of Croatia's pristine karst topography. From Pariževačka Glavica, you can observe towering limestone cliffs, deeply carved by the Zrmanja River over millennia. The river itself is known for its tufa and travertine rock sediments, particularly in its tributary, the Krupa river, which forms numerous waterfalls, though these may not be directly visible from this specific viewpoint.
Pariževačka Glavica is renowned for its breathtaking 360-degree panoramic views, offering an unparalleled perspective of the Zrmanja River's winding path through the canyon. It's often highlighted for its dramatic, cinematic scenery and sense of untouched nature. While other viewpoints along the Zrmanja may offer different angles or closer proximity to the river, Pariževačka Glavica is widely considered one of the most iconic and impressive for its expansive vistas and historical significance as a 'Winnetou' filming location.
Given the rocky terrain, especially near the viewpoint, it's advisable to wear comfortable and sturdy footwear, such as hiking shoes or robust sneakers. Depending on the season, layers are recommended, as the weather can change. Sun protection (hat, sunscreen) is also wise, especially during warmer months, as the viewpoint is exposed.
